Driving directions from Donghan, China to Surabaya, Indonesia distance


Donghan, China
Surabaya, Indonesia
Donghan to Surabaya road map

Donghan to Surabaya flight distance miles / km

2,304.5 mi / 3,708.8 km
Also see in China
Of interest in Indonesia